Google maps api 3 Openlayers-如何限制google/bing层中的缩放数量?

Google maps api 3 Openlayers-如何限制google/bing层中的缩放数量?,google-maps-api-3,openlayers,openstreetmap,Google Maps Api 3,Openlayers,Openstreetmap,我想有5个缩放级别只有在谷歌/bing层在OL 在这个Fiddle示例中,我有OSM/Bing/Google层 对于OSM层,我是这样做的: var resolutions = OpenLayers.Layer.Bing.prototype.serverResolutions.slice(16, 20); var osm = new OpenLayers.Layer.OSM("OSM", null, { zoomOffset: 16, resolutions:

我想有5个缩放级别只有在谷歌/bing层在OL

在这个Fiddle示例中,我有OSM/Bing/Google层

对于OSM层,我是这样做的:

var resolutions = OpenLayers.Layer.Bing.prototype.serverResolutions.slice(16, 20);
var osm = new OpenLayers.Layer.OSM("OSM", null, {
        zoomOffset: 16,
        resolutions: resolutions
    });
我如何使用google&bing层实现同样的功能? 我想在左侧显示只有5个缩放级别的缩放栏


Thx.

你读过了吗?我看到了,它可以与OSM层一起工作,但不能与google层一起工作。覆盖
isValidZoomLevel()
函数无效?它没有给我缩放偏移量。我将使用JSFIDLE示例更新问题。